LaNi3 is an intermetallic compound composed of lanthanum and nickel, belonging to the rare-earth metal family. It is widely recognized as a hydrogen storage material and is the active constituent in nickel-metal hydride (NiMH) battery electrodes, where it reversibly absorbs and releases hydrogen to enable charge cycling. Its exceptional hydrogen absorption capacity and electrochemical stability make it a preferred choice over simpler nickel alloys in portable power applications, though it is also explored in hydrogen energy storage and catalytic applications.
